Windows系统轻松安装CUDA 11.6、PyTorch 1.12.0与Python 3.9,助你一路畅通!
2023-06-25 01:57:54
踏上深度学习之旅:安装 CUDA、Python 和 PyTorch 的指南
一、奠定坚实基础:安装 CUDA 11.6
CUDA 11.6 是一个并行计算平台,可加速深度学习模型的训练和推理。让我们从它的安装开始:
-
获取 CUDA 安装程序: 前往 NVIDIA 网站,选择与你的操作系统和显卡型号兼容的 CUDA 11.6 安装程序。
-
启动安装: 运行下载的安装程序,按照屏幕提示完成安装过程。
-
设置环境变量: 在系统环境变量中添加 CUDA 相关变量,包括 CUDA_HOME、CUDA_PATH 和 PATH。
二、搭建核心平台:安装 Python 3.9
Python 是深度学习领域广泛使用的编程语言。让我们安装 Python 3.9:
-
获取 Python 安装程序: 从 Python 官网下载适用于你操作系统的 Python 3.9 安装程序。
-
完成安装: 运行安装程序,并按照提示安装 Python。
-
设置环境变量: 添加 Python 相关环境变量,包括 PYTHON_HOME 和 PATH。
三、激活深度学习引擎:安装 PyTorch 1.12.0
PyTorch 是一个用于深度学习的 Python 库。接下来,我们将安装 PyTorch 1.12.0:
-
获取 PyTorch 安装包: 前往 PyTorch 官网,下载与你的系统兼容的 PyTorch 1.12.0 安装包。
-
复制安装包: 将下载的 PyTorch 安装包复制到 Python 安装目录的 Lib\site-packages 文件夹。
-
验证安装: 在命令行中输入 pip install torch。如果安装成功,你将看到安装完成的消息。
四、点亮成功之光:测试安装
为了验证我们的安装,让我们运行一个简单的测试脚本:
import torch
x = torch.tensor([1, 2, 3])
print(x)
-
创建脚本: 创建一个名为 test.py 的 Python 脚本,并将代码粘贴其中。
-
运行脚本: 在命令行中导航到脚本所在目录,并输入 python test.py。
-
检查输出: 如果输出为 [1, 2, 3],恭喜!PyTorch 安装成功。
五、深入探索:更多可能性的开启
现在,你已经安装了 PyTorch,接下来可以探索:
-
扩展工具箱: 学习 PyTorch 的高级特性,例如张量操作、神经网络搭建和训练。
-
揭开深度学习的奥秘: 从基础理论到实际应用,不断挖掘深度学习的魅力。
-
加入社区: 与 PyTorch 和深度学习社区互动,交流想法和经验。
六、开启你的深度学习之旅
现在,你已经掌握了安装 CUDA 11.6、PyTorch 1.12.0 和 Python 3.9 的技巧,你已经为开启深度学习之旅做好了准备。踏上征途,点亮人工智能的未来!
常见问题解答
1. 安装 CUDA 时遇到问题怎么办?
确保你的显卡与 CUDA 版本兼容,并正确设置了环境变量。
2. 无法安装 PyTorch?
请确认你已经安装了 CUDA 和 Python,并且复制了正确的安装包。
3. 我需要哪些额外的软件?
可能还需要一个文本编辑器(例如 VSCode)和一个 IDE(例如 PyCharm)。
4. 如何开始深度学习?
从在线课程、教程和书籍中学习基础知识。
5. 我可以从哪里获得帮助?
在 PyTorch 和深度学习社区中寻求支持,或者查看官方文档。